Engineering Tertiary Lymphoid Structures: Nanomedicine, Bioengineering, and Biomaterials for Precision Immunotherapy

open access: yesAdvanced NanoBiomed Research, EarlyView.
This review explains how biomaterials and nanoparticles can be used to induce or modulate tertiary lymphoid structures (TLSs), which are ectopic immune hubs that form in nonlymphoid tissues during chronic disease and cancer. By comparing different methods, the article highlights design principles for modeling TLSs or recapitulating specific TLS ...

Plastron respiration using commercial fabrics [PDF]

open access: yes, 2014
A variety of insect and arachnid species are able to remain submerged in water indefinitely using plastron respiration. A plastron is a surface-retained film of air produced by surface morphology that acts as an oxygen-carbon dioxide exchange surface ...
